Emerson�������s Theory of Poetry: Compiled from the Works and Journals is a book written by Charles Howell Foster. The book is a comprehensive compilation of Ralph Waldo Emerson's works and journals, focusing on his theory of poetry. Emerson was a prominent American philosopher, essayist, and poet who played a significant role in the Transcendentalist movement in the 19th century. The book delves into Emerson's philosophy of poetry, analyzing his views on the nature of poetry, the role of the poet, and the relationship between poetry and society. The author has carefully curated and organized Emerson's ideas on poetry from his various works and journals, providing readers with a coherent and comprehensive understanding of his theory.The book is divided into different sections, each focusing on a specific aspect of Emerson's theory of poetry. The first section explores Emerson's views on the nature of poetry, discussing his ideas on the essence of poetry, its purpose, and its relationship with language. The second section delves into the role of the poet, examining Emerson's thoughts on the poet as a visionary, a prophet, and a seer.The third section of the book explores the relationship between poetry and society, analyzing Emerson's views on the role of poetry in shaping cultural and social values.
